sql >> Databáze >  >> RDS >> Oracle

Jak změnit zápornou hodnotu na kladnou v Oracle?

V Oracle použijte ABS funkci změnit zápornou hodnotu na kladnou hodnotu. Tato funkce bere jako argument jakýkoli číselný datový typ a vrací absolutní hodnotu.

Syntaxe

ABS(n)

Příklady funkcí Oracle ABS

1. Pomocí příkazu Vybrat

SELECT ABS(-15) Positive_value FROM DUAL;

Výstup

POSITIVE_VALUE
--------------
15
1 row selected.

2. Použití PL/SQL Block

SET SERVEROUTPUT ON;
DECLARE
n_value NUMBER;
BEGIN
n_value := ABS(-9);
DBMS_OUTPUT.PUT_LINE (n_value);
END;
/

Výstup

9
PL/SQL procedure successfully completed.

Viz také

  • Příklad funkce SUBSTR s INSTR
  • Zaokrouhlení na nejbližší 0,25 v Oracle
  1. Jak používat připravené výpisy s Postgres

  2. Měly by být nové sloupce indexu v klíči nebo zahrnuty?

  3. Nástroje pro správu SQL Server 2017

  4. TO_SECONDS() Příklady – MySQL